Gnawa Diffusion — artist
Gnawa Diffusion is a musical group known for blending traditional North African Gnawa music with a variety of contemporary genres, including rock, reggae, and hip-hop. Formed in 1992 in Grenoble, France, the band draws notable influences from both Algerian folk traditions and global musical styles, creating a unique fusion that resonates with diverse audiences. Their sound is characterized by rhythmic guembri bass lines, vibrant percussion, and socially conscious lyrics, often addressing themes of identity and cultural heritage.
